Today on the Friends in Beauty Podcast Akua shares her tips for curing comparison syndrome

 

This something that we all go through from time to time. I mean, we’re only human right. It’s hard to resist the urge to compare ourselves to others. But there’s a thin line between healthy and unhealthy comparisons. If you’re observing someone in admiration & using them as motivation to step up your game that can be considered a healthy comparison. However, when the thoughts turn inward and become negative when you’re comparing one person’s results to what you have not achieved it can become unhealthy.

 

Comparison Syndrome is a recipe for disaster, lower self-esteem, depression, envy, and unhappiness. You end up ultimately resenting others for being successful and that’s not the type of energy that will serve you well and make you productive towards your goals.
